Vue Realtime Dashboard

screenshot of Vue Realtime Dashboard
express
vue
firebase

a simple vuejs realtime dashboard with firebase, google maps & chartjs

Overview

The Vue Realtime Dashboard is a powerful tool that leverages Vue.js to create a sleek and modern dashboard interface. Integrating elements like Firebase for real-time data updates, Google Maps for geographical data visualization, and Chart.js for dynamic graphing, this dashboard offers a comprehensive solution for any data-driven project. Designed with a focus on material design principles, it ensures an appealing user experience while maintaining functionality.

With the ability to pull and display real-time data seamlessly, the Vue Realtime Dashboard is ideal for developers looking to create interactive applications. Whether you are monitoring user activity, visualizing sales data, or tracking project progress, this dashboard provides the flexibility and tools required to achieve your goals.

Features

  • Real-Time Data Integration: Utilizing Firebase, the dashboard updates automatically to reflect changes in data without requiring page refreshes.
  • Material Design Interface: The dashboard boasts a modern and attractive design, following material design guidelines to enhance usability.
  • Interactive Maps: Features Google Maps integration, allowing for geolocation data to be displayed and interacted with easily.
  • Dynamic Graphs: Chart.js integration provides various graph types to visualize data trends effectively and clearly.
  • Responsive Design: Fully responsive layout ensures the dashboard looks great on both desktop and mobile devices.
  • Easy Setup: Designed for developers with straightforward setup instructions, making it user-friendly even for those new to Vue.js.
  • Documentation Available: Comprehensive guides and documentation support users in exploring and customizing the dashboard to fit their specific needs.
express
Express

Express.js is a simple Node.js framework for single, multi-page, and hybrid web applications.

vue
Vue

Vue.js is a lightweight and flexible JavaScript framework that allows developers to easily build dynamic and reactive user interfaces. Its intuitive syntax, modular architecture, and focus on performance make it a popular choice for modern web development.

firebase
Firebase

Firebase offers a comprehensive set of features, including real-time database, authentication, hosting, cloud functions, storage, and more. Firebase provides an easy-to-use interface and allows developers to focus on building features rather than managing infrastructure.

eslint
Eslint

ESLint is a linter for JavaScript that analyzes code to detect and report on potential problems and errors, as well as enforce consistent code style and best practices, helping developers to write cleaner, more maintainable code.

webpack
Webpack

Webpack is a popular open-source module bundler for JavaScript applications that bundles and optimizes the code and its dependencies for production-ready deployment. It can also be used to transform other types of assets such as CSS, images, and fonts.